4. Alexander, born on the 7th of January, 1774, and died in France, without issue.
5. Thomas, who on the death of his eldest brother, John, in 1838, became the representative of the family.
6. Hector, born on the 8th of May, 1778, and died in 1814, without issue.
7. James, a clergyman, born on the 26th of September, 1785, and died without issue, in 1811.
8. Elspet, who married John MacConnachie, Tombain, with issue.
9. Margaret, who died without issue, in 1812.
William died in June, 1813, at Lyne of Carron, was buried at Aberlour, and succeeded as representative of the family by his eldest son,
V. JOHN MACKENZIE, who died without issue in 1838, when he was succeeded as representative of the family by his eldest surviving brother,
VI. THOMAS MACKENZIE, who was born on the 12th of April, 1776, and married on the 26th of July, 1821, Ann Grant, great-grand-daughter of Ludovick Grant, grandson of Sir John Grant of Freuchy, with issue -
1. William, his heir and successor.
